Aliens is getting the single-player, action-horror treatment on consoles, PC, and VR
Developer Survios is teaming up with 20th Century Fox to create a new single-player, action-horror game based on the Alien franchise.
Details on the new venture - currently being referred to as"Aliens" - are pretty scarce right now, with Surviosit'll feature an original storyline set somewhere between the events of Alien and Aliens, with players taking on the role of a"battle hardened veteran [with] a vendetta against the Xenomorphs".
Given Survios' background as a primarily VR-focused developer - it's worked on the likes of Creed: Rise to Glory, The Walking Dead Onslaught, and Puzzle Bobble 3D: Vacation Odyssey - it won't be much of a surprise to hear its new Aliens project is also be getting the VR treatment.However, the game - which is being made in Unreal Engine 5 - is additionally listed as launching for PC and consoles, suggesting it'll be playable as a more traditional non-VR experience too.
